/* Benjamin DELPY `gentilkiwi` http://blog.gentilkiwi.com benjamin@gentilkiwi.com Licence : http://creativecommons.org/licenses/by/3.0/fr/ */ #pragma once #include "globdefs.h" #include "mod_system.h" #include "mod_privilege.h" #include class mod_mimikatz_privilege { private: static bool multiplePrivs(vector * privs, DWORD type); static bool simplePriv(wstring priv, vector * arguments); public: static vector getMimiKatzCommands(); static bool list(vector * arguments); static bool enable(vector * arguments); static bool remove(vector * arguments); static bool disable(vector * arguments); static bool debug(vector * arguments); static bool security(vector * arguments); static bool tcb(vector * arguments); static bool impersonate(vector * arguments); static bool assign(vector * arguments); static bool shutdown(vector * arguments); static bool takeowner(vector * arguments); };